Default winter blooming catt hybrid recommendations?

Hi all--

Well, I'm in the throes of the Ohio winter doldrums and figured I needed to find a couple of orchids to help me survive it (lol) and was wondering if I could get some recommendations for winter blooming catt hybrids? I'd like the following characteristics if possible:

1: Relatively delicate flowers and stems with flowers held above the foliage. I do like some rufflling, but huge/heavy/waxy flowers aren't as attractive to me.

2: Compact size (love the big ones, but just don't have room--under 15" is best)

3: Prefer "clear" colors--tropic pinks, yellows, etc. Mauves, oranges, burgundies aren't attractive to me.

4: Fragrance--prefer light/citrus/spice.

5: Growing conditions: intermediate range

Thanks in advance!
